How To Cook Pork Loin Roast

Ingredients

2-3 lb. Pork Loin Roast
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on onion powder
1 teaspoon paprika
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per

Instructions

1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
2. In a small bowl, combine gar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
3. Place pork loin roast on a baking sheet and rub the seasoning mixture onto the roast.
4. Bake for about 1 hour or until the internal temperature of the roast reaches 145 degrees F.
5. Remove from oven and let rest for 10 minutes before slicing.

Tips

For added flavor, you can rub some olive oil or butter onto the pork loin roast before adding the seasoning mixture. You can also add other seasonings such as rosemary, thyme, or oregano for a delicious flavor. If you don’t have a thermometer, you can test for doneness by piercing the roast with a fork and ensuring the juices run clear.
